And then on electric vehicles coming on to the road. Well, some are mostly electric. The Chevy Volt is neither a hybrid nor a truly solely electric vehicle. And thats because there is also a gas engine. So Chevy is calling it an extended range electric vehicle and thats exactly what it does. Basically, the electric mode will work for about 50 miles or so and after that point the gas engine is designed to kick in and give you a lot more miles. Like every other electric vehicle, its quiet, its very smooth ride, its actually a pretty fun ride. Now the readouts on the displays here there is some tacky stuff going on, you can see how much of the battery is left; you can see whether you are an efficient driver; if youre pushing too much in the accelerator or if you are using up too much of the battery. Now all of these are not gonna come cheap by the way, the manufacturer suggested retail price for the Chevy Volt is about $41,000, which is definitely more than some of the electric vehicles out there on the market. You do get about $7000 federal tax credit because of the clean energy component of this car. But still left about $33,000 since the investment for people and you have to hope you get it back while have seen that spending as much on gas.
